C++
C++ cerr 총정리
수달정보보호
2024. 3. 10. 08:00
1. cerr의 개념
cerr은 표준 오류 스트림으로, 오류를 출력하는 데 사용된다. 이것은 ostream의 인스턴스로, err 스트림은 오류 메시지를 즉시 표시해야 할 때 사용된다. 나중에 표시할 오류 메시지를 저장하지는 않는다는 것이다. C 스트림의 stderr에 해당한다. cerr에서 c는 문자를 의미하고, err는 error를 의미하므로, cerr은 문자 오류를 뜻한다. 오류를 표시하기 위해 cerr을 사용하는 것은 분명 좋은 방법이라 할 수 있겠다.
예시:
// C++ program to illustrate std::cerr
#include <iostream>
using namespace std;
// Driver Code
int main()
{
// This will print "Welcome to Gutilog"
// in the error window
cerr << "Welcome to Gutilog! :: cerr";
return 0;
}
위 프로그램에서 12번 라인의 출력은 오류 창을 표시하게 된다.
출력:
Welcome to Gutilog! :: cerr
728x90